summaryrefslogtreecommitdiff
path: root/lib/windows-spawn.c
diff options
context:
space:
mode:
authorBruno Haible <bruno@clisp.org>2020-12-14 20:56:04 +0100
committerBruno Haible <bruno@clisp.org>2020-12-14 23:48:26 +0100
commit0299e540e47d71207081f87de6ec7aa2ceed5d25 (patch)
treed41ef944841b2a29e42f788c936b163ea08bb103 /lib/windows-spawn.c
parent29d55bf8c7d0c5a4a3b4aa2d93d897ff8463eb4c (diff)
downloadgnulib-0299e540e47d71207081f87de6ec7aa2ceed5d25.tar.gz
findprog-in: Allow overriding the current directory.
* lib/findprog.h (find_in_given_path): Add directory argument. * lib/findprog-in.c (find_in_given_path): Likewise. * lib/execute.c (execute): Update caller. * lib/spawn-pipe.c (create_pipe): Likewise. * lib/windows-spawn.c (spawnpvech): Likewise. * NEWS: Mention the change.
Diffstat (limited to 'lib/windows-spawn.c')
-rw-r--r--lib/windows-spawn.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/windows-spawn.c b/lib/windows-spawn.c
index 509727c74e..19251aea97 100644
--- a/lib/windows-spawn.c
+++ b/lib/windows-spawn.c
@@ -223,7 +223,7 @@ spawnpvech (int mode,
/* Implement the 'p' letter: search for PROGNAME in getenv ("PATH"). */
const char *resolved_progname =
- find_in_given_path (progname, getenv ("PATH"), false);
+ find_in_given_path (progname, getenv ("PATH"), NULL, false);
if (resolved_progname == NULL)
return -1;